Problems or solutions
- SIAM and Pearson's 2 coefficient are zero when average equals median.
- SIAM and Pearson's 2 coefficient are invariant when the data set is multiplied by a constant factor.
- SIAM but not Pearson's 2 coefficient correlates with coefficient of variation when the data set is baseline corrected by a constant factor.
- SIAM changes after a data set is baseline corrected by a constant factor, which changes x at a given SD. This does not affect Pearson's 2 index.
- SIAM changes from flux control ratio Y/Z to flux control efficiency 1-Y/Z, which changes x at a given SD. This does not affect Pearson's 2 index. In both cases the sign is changed.
